| Shipyard | A.G. Weser, Bremen (Werk 226) |
| Ordered | 23 Nov 1914 | Laid down | 27 Jan 1915 |
| Launched | 29 Apr 1915 | Commissioned | 2 May 1915 |
| Commanders | |
| Career | 7 patrols |
27 Jun 1915 - 16 Mar 1916 Pola Flotilla
|
| Successes | 6 ships sunk for a total of 3,289 tons. |
| Fate | 16 Mar 1916 - Sunk by explosion of her own mines off Taranto 4027N 1711E. 15 dead |
| The Italians raised UC 12, and commissioned it in their navy as the X-1. |
